基于RFID的智能仓储管理系统的设计与实现

时间:2016-09-12来源:网络
基于RFID的智能仓储管理系统的设计与实现

4.3 商品管理界面

商品管理是整个上位机操作的核心。为了获得数据库中的数据来填充数据集以显示具体信息,需在数据访问类StorageDB中构建成员函数,实现对各个表的调用从而显示表中的具体信息。这里入库出库信息的显示就是在成员函数中对入库出库表的调用,从而显示入库出库信息的目的。商品管理界面包含商品编号以及对应的商品名称。同时具有添加商品和删除商品的功能。

当库存货物中没有该商品时,可对该商品进行添加操作。当不再需要该商品时,可对该商品进行删除操作,及时更新数据。这里为了及时更新数据库中的数据,同样在StorageDB中构建了函数BooleanUpdateTable。

通过SqlCommandBuilder GoodsTableBurider=new Sql CommandBuilder(adapter)来实现对数据的更新。DataGrid控件绑定数据访问类GoodsTable属性,并实现增加商品,删除商品功能,其具体实现也是调用数据访问类中函数来实现。

应用双向数据绑定,从StorageDB对象中提取信息供界面显示、操作。减少后台代码复杂的操作,方便了数据的更新和多界面间数据的同步。各文本框分别绑定。

Text=“{Binding Path=GoodsNumber}”

Text=“{Binding Path=GoodsName}”

Text=“{Binding Path=GoodsDescription}”

在相关文本框中进行修改后点击更新调用数据访问类中的更新函数,即可更新到数据库中。如图6所示。在管理界面左上角显示的UII单品搜索文本框中输入标签的UII即可查询单个UII的详细记录。其详细记录包括商品的注册信息,入库信息和出库信息等。

基于RFID的智能仓储管理系统的设计与实现

5 结束语

本文主要介绍了一套RFID与计算机终端管理软件相结合的智能仓储管理系统。实现了货物智能化的入库出库,完整的货物信息浏览,对商品的分类管理和动态盘点,可以有效提高仓储效率,具有一定的应用价值。

1 2

关键词: RFID 智能仓储 管理系统 数据库

加入微信
获取电子行业最新资讯
搜索微信公众号:EEPW

或用微信扫描左侧二维码

相关文章

查看电脑版